My friend
47_trek_47's novel I Just Play One on TV has been released today by Torquere Press!
You probably know Torquere mostly as publishers of m/m romance and erotica. I Just Play One on TV definitely has a romance element--it's about the relationship of two gay actors costarring in a hit TV show--but it's also very much about the way homophobia still shapes Hollywood, both what we see onscreen and the way LGBT actors are pressured to stay in the closet. I promise you, it does not contain a single violet-eyed elf prince.
